2013/7/20 Murphy McCauley <[email protected]> > Let me try restating. > > Imagine you have a hardware switch. It has some ports which connect it to > other switches and hosts and stuff -- it makes a network (call this the > "data network" for lack of a better term). > > So if it's an OpenFlow switch, where is the controller in this picture? > > One type configuration, the controller can be anywhere on the data > network. It communicates with the switch over IP, so why not? You have > OpenFlow mixed with normal traffic all over your network. (This is often > called "in band control") > > In another type of configuration (out of band control), you set aside one > port on each switch as "special", and use this port to connect to the > controller. The special port is *not* a part of the data network. You > might say it's part of a control or management network. No normal > forwarding ever takes place over this port -- *only* OpenFlow. > > > If your setup looks like the first configuration, a controller can easily > send arbitrary traffic over the data network using plain old socket > programming. But if your configuration is similar to the second option, > there's no direct way for the controller to send to or receive from the > data network. The only way it can do it is over OpenFlow -- by instructing > one of the switches to send data (via a packet out) and having the switch > send data to the controller (via packet in). > > Of course, even in the second configuration, you could run a cable between > a second interface on the controller and a normal port on the switch.
